Preston, Inc., manufactures wooden shelving units for collecting and sorting mail. The company expects to produce 260 units in July and 380 units in August. Each unit requires 13 feet of wood at a cost of $0.80 per foot. Preston wants to always have 290 feet of wood on hand in materials inventory. Compute Preston's direct materials purchases budget for July and August.
